【建模必备】遗传算法的基本原理与步骤(适应度函数与适应度分配)

如果喜欢这里的内容,你能够给我最大的帮助就是转发,告诉你的朋友,鼓励他们一起来学习。

If you like the content here, you can give me the greatest help is forwarding, tell your friends, encourage them to learn together.

1
2
3
4
5
6

  • 17
    点赞
  • 87
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 1
    评论
遗传算法是一种模拟自然选择和遗传机制的优化算法,常用于求解复杂的优化问题。在数学建模中,遗传算法可以应用于多个领域,以下是一些经典的应用实例: 1. 旅行商问题(TSP):遗传算法可以用于解决旅行商问题,即找到一条最短路径经过多个城市。通过将路径表示为染色体,城市之间的距离作为适应度函数遗传算法可以不断进化出更短的路径。 2. 机器学习:遗传算法可以应用于机器学习任务中的特征选择、参数优化等问题。通过对个体的基因表示进行变异和交叉操作,遗传算法可以搜索最佳的特征子集或参数组合,提高机器学习模型的性能。 3. 资源分配问题:遗传算法可以用于解决资源分配问题,如货物装载问题、作业调度问题等。通过将资源和任务表示为染色体,遗传算法可以自动优化资源的分配,以最大化效益或最小化成本。 4. 网络优化:遗传算法可以用于网络优化问题,如网络路由、传感器部署等。通过将网络拓扑表示为染色体,遗传算法可以搜索最佳的拓扑结构或节点位置,以提高网络的性能和覆盖范围。 5. 参数估计:遗传算法可以用于参数估计问题,如数理统计中的参数估计、物理模型中的参数优化等。通过将参数表示为染色体,遗传算法可以搜索最佳的参数组合,以拟合实际观测数据或优化模型的性能。 这些是数学建模遗传算法的一些应用实例,遗传算法在不同领域和问题中都具有广泛的应用。通过模拟自然选择和遗传机制,遗传算法能够寻找最优解或接近最优解的解决方案。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

青少年编程备考

感谢您的支持!

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值